So, but I of a strange one. It’s now resolved but would be interested to hear views on what caused the issue.
I use an iPhone 15 pro max with a physical SIM on EE and an eSIM for o2. Has been working fine since Jan last year.
Around 5:30 yesterday evening, i noticed that the O2 connection was showing no bars of signal whatsoever, and it remained this way for a few hours. I tried turning the phone off and on, and resetting network settings but to no avail. The phone recognised the eSIM still but just wouldn’t connect. What I did notice is in the settings, it was showing “SIM not provisioned”
more worryingly, anyone calling me wasnt getting my voicemail, instead they were told that the number didn’t exist / they had dialled an incorrect number!
Spoke to O2 this morning and ignoring the challenges with the call centre, they finally managed to sort out a replacement eSIM which I downloaded via the O2 app which fixed it.
I’m curious as to what could have caused the issue in the first place?
